Kodiak Island Resort sits along the shoreline of Larsen Bay on Kodiak Island. The lodge offers complete luxury for guests to enjoy while not fishing. Sat amid some of Alaska's most pristine wilderness guest's of the lodge really do have the best of everything - excellent fishing, beautiful views, and incredible saltwater and freshwater fishing.
Fishing with Kodiak Island Resort
The Lodge is open from May all the way through October. During those prime months, guests have many options for fishing. Expect to experience fishing for barn door Halibut. Expect to enjoy world-class Salmon fishing for King Salmon and Silver Salmon. All five species of Pacific Salmon are available. In addition, these calm and protected waters are home to big Ling Cod and Bottom Fish. It is a rare day when guests of Kodiak Island Resort do not catch their daily limit for Halibut, Salmon, or Bottom Fish.
If you are thinking it does not get much better than this, then buckle your seatbelt. Guests also have the option of fly-in fishing to some of the most amazing spots. This is an excellent location for fly fishing for Steelhead and Rainbow Trout too.
Lodging with the Kodiak Island Resort
The Food here is just as good as the fishing. Guests enjoy the executive lounge where there are plenty of hor d'oeuvres and drinks. Expect five-star meals and a menu that is richly diverse.
Lodging is via one of their six double occupancy rooms with two double beds. Each room has a private bathroom and spectacular views. Expect comfortable rooms plenty of style and luxury.
In your downtime, there are a million things to do and see. Guests enjoy beach combing, whale watching, and just relaxing.
